Responsibilities

  • Examine complex title orders to determine conditions of title and by considering the effect of documents such as mortgage, liens, judgments and other vital statistics to determine ownership, legal restrictions, and verify legal description; Review final products to ensure quality standards are met.
  • Explain chain of title, exceptions, and requirements to customers and managers.
  • Assess risks and liabilities that may jeopardize the Company and escalate, as appropriate.
  • Prepare accurate and comprehensive title reports in accordance with Company policies and examining procedures.
  • Request any items needed to clear deficiencies in title search packages prior to release.
  • Procure onsite documents from county locations as needed.
